Directs the state fire prevention and building code council to update the state fire prevention and building code and the state energy conservation construction code within 18 months of the publication of any updated or revised edition of the international and national codes relating thereto, so as to ensure that the state's codes reflect such revisions and updates.

AN ACT to amend the executive law and the energy law, in relation to
requiring the updating of the state uniform fire prevention and build-
ing code and the state energy conservation construction code on the
basis of update of certain international codes
The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-bly, do enact as follows:
1 Section 1. Subdivision 2 of section 377 of the executive law is renum-
2 bered subdivision 3 and a new subdivision 2 is added to read as follows:
3 2. Each time a revised or updated edition of the International Build-
4 ing Code, the International Fire Code, the International Residential
5 Code, the International Plumbing Code, the International Mechanical
6 Code, the International Fuel Gas Code, the International Existing Build-
7 ing Code, the International Property Maintenance Code or the National
8 Electrical Code is published, the council shall, eighteen months after
9 publication of a revised or updated edition, cause the uniform fire
10 prevention and building code to be updated to reflect changes in any
11 such revised or updated edition. To the extent that the uniform fire
12 prevention and building code has not been updated to reflect changes in
13 any such revised or updated edition as of the effective date of this
14 subdivision, the council shall, as soon as practicable and no later than
15 eighteen months after the effective date of this subdivision, cause the
16 uniform fire prevention and building code to be updated to reflect such
17 changes.

9 § 3. Subdivision 2 of section 11-103 of the energy law, as amended by
10 chapter 374 of the laws of 2022, is amended to read as follows:
11 2. (a) The state fire prevention and building code council is author-
12 ized, from time to time as it deems appropriate and consistent with the
13 purposes of this article, to review and amend the code, or adopt a new
14 code, through rules and regulations provided that the code remains cost
15 effective with respect to building construction in the state. In deter-
16 mining whether the code remains cost effective, the code council shall
17 consider (i) whether the life-cycle costs for a building will be recov-
18 ered through savings in energy costs over the design life of the build-
19 ing under a life-cycle cost analysis performed under methodology as
20 established by the New York state energy research and development
21 authority in regulations which may be updated from time to time, and
22 (ii) secondary or societal effects, such as reductions in greenhouse gas
23 emissions, as defined in regulations. Before publication of a notice of
24 proposed rule making establishing the methodology or defining secondary
25 or societal effects, the president of the authority shall conduct public
26 meetings to provide meaningful opportunities for public comment from all
27 segments of the population that would be impacted by the regulations,
28 including persons living in disadvantaged communities as identified by
29 the climate justice working group established under section 75-0111 of
30 the environmental conservation law. For residential buildings, the code
31 shall meet or exceed the then most recently published International
32 Energy Conservation Code, or achieve equivalent or greater energy
33 savings; and for commercial buildings, the code shall meet or exceed the
34 then most recently published [ASHRAE] ANSI/ASHRAE/IESNA Standard 90.1,
35 or achieve equivalent or greater energy savings.
